Originations Managing Director – CIFC Asset Management Location
New York, NY Base pay range
$250,000.00/yr - $400,000.00/yr Other compensation
Annual Bonus Overview
CIFC Asset Management provides institutional credit management across CLOs, structured credit, corporate credit, opportunistic credit and direct lending. This position will be primarily responsible for sourcing new transactions, underwriting support, monitoring existing positions, maintaining client relationships, and actively marketing to promote the CIFC Direct Lending brand. Candidates should have a background in middle-market loan originations with underwriting, modeling, and credit documentation skills to preliminarily assess opportunities, support underwriting, and help close and monitor investments. Key Responsibilities
Responsible for sourcing, evaluating, structuring, executing, and closing new investments, working with CIFC DL underwriting teams and portfolio managers. Strong ability to evaluate, analyze and structure middle-market opportunities. Strong credit, execution, presentation, documentation, and closing capabilities. Developing a territory marketing plan, developing and maintaining sponsor/referral source relationships, identifying, structuring, negotiating documents and closing investments, managing deal processes from sourcing to closing including presenting deals to IC, and meeting new business development objectives. Skills, Experience & Attributes Required
15+ years of relevant deal sourcing and closing experience Track record of meeting qualitative and quantitative goals Strong, tenured relationships with private equity sponsors and other deal sources Familiarity with MS Office Suite Strong credit and presentation skills Strong product and market knowledge High level of integrity and market credibility Seniority level
